Factors Influencing Whitetail Deer Round Selection
Choosing the right ammunition for whitetail deer hunting involves a nuanced understanding of several key factors. Ballistic performance is paramount, encompassing bullet weight, construction, and velocity. Heavier bullets generally retain more energy downrange, crucial for delivering a decisive blow through bone and muscle, while lighter, faster rounds can offer flatter trajectories for longer shots. Bullet construction dictates how the projectile behaves upon impact. Expanding bullets, such as soft points or controlled expansion designs, are engineered to mushroom and create a larger wound channel, maximizing energy transfer and promoting quick, humane kills. Conversely, monolithic bullets, often made from copper, offer excellent weight retention and penetration but may require slightly faster velocities to achieve reliable expansion. Understanding the typical engagement ranges for whitetail hunting in your preferred terrain is also critical. Open plains might favor flatter-shooting cartridges, while dense woodlands could see hunters prioritizing close-range effectiveness and the ability to navigate brush without significant bullet deflection.
The intended rifle platform and its operational characteristics play a significant role in round selection. Different rifle actions, from bolt-actions to semi-automatics, can influence how well certain cartridges feed and cycle. The twist rate of the barrel is another crucial consideration, as it determines the optimal bullet weight and length for stabilization. A faster twist rate is generally required to stabilize longer, heavier bullets, which are often favored for their ballistic coefficients and retained energy. Ammunition availability and cost are practical considerations that should not be overlooked. While some highly specialized cartridges offer exceptional performance, they may be difficult to find or prohibitively expensive for regular practice and hunting. Conversely, common and widely available rounds often strike a balance between performance and affordability, making them a practical choice for most hunters.
Environmental conditions and ethical considerations are equally important when determining the best rounds for whitetail. The typical weather patterns of your hunting region can subtly affect ballistic performance, with extreme cold or heat potentially influencing powder burn rates and thus velocity. More importantly, the ethical imperative of a clean, humane kill must guide every ammunition choice. This means selecting rounds that are proven to reliably incapacitate the animal quickly, minimizing suffering. Understanding the anatomy of a whitetail deer, particularly the location of vital organs like the heart and lungs, informs the desired penetration and expansion characteristics of the bullet. Over-penetration with inadequate expansion can lead to wounded animals, while insufficient penetration can result in non-lethal hits.
Finally, personal experience and rifle compatibility are invaluable guides. What works well in one rifle may not perform identically in another, even with the same cartridge. Testing different ammunition loads in your specific rifle is essential to identify the most accurate and reliable performer. This often involves shooting for accuracy at various distances to establish reliable hunting parameters. Furthermore, consulting with experienced whitetail hunters, rifle manufacturers, and local wildlife agencies can provide practical insights and recommendations tailored to your specific hunting environment and preferences. This collective wisdom can help refine your understanding and ensure you make informed decisions about ammunition.
Understanding Ballistic Performance for Whitetail
Ballistic performance encompasses a range of characteristics that determine a bullet’s effectiveness on game. For whitetail deer, a primary concern is retained energy downrange. As a bullet travels, it loses velocity and, consequently, energy. Choosing cartridges that deliver sufficient energy to penetrate vital organs and cause catastrophic tissue damage at your expected hunting distances is crucial. This is often expressed in foot-pounds (ft-lbs) of energy. Another critical aspect is the ballistic coefficient (BC) of the bullet. A higher BC indicates a more aerodynamically efficient bullet, which will maintain its velocity and trajectory better over longer distances. This translates to a flatter shooting bullet, requiring less adjustment for windage and elevation when making longer shots.
Bullet construction significantly influences terminal ballistics, the way a bullet behaves after impact. For whitetail, controlled expansion bullets are highly regarded. These are designed to open up and mushroom upon hitting tissue, creating a wider wound channel and dumping energy effectively for a quick, humane kill. Examples include ballistic tip bullets, partition bullets, and bonded core bullets. Partition bullets, with their internal divider, offer a good balance of expansion and weight retention, ensuring deep penetration even after the front portion expands. Bonded core bullets fuse the jacket and core, preventing excessive fragmentation and ensuring better penetration through heavier bone structures.
The relationship between velocity and bullet construction is also vital. Many expanding bullets require a minimum velocity threshold to achieve reliable expansion. If a bullet is traveling too slowly upon impact, it may fail to expand properly, leading to reduced energy transfer and potentially a poor outcome. Conversely, bullets fired at extremely high velocities can sometimes fragment too violently, sacrificing penetration for rapid expansion. Understanding the optimal velocity window for your chosen bullet type and cartridge is therefore essential for maximizing terminal performance on whitetail deer. This often means selecting cartridges that offer a good compromise of velocity, energy, and bullet design suited for the typical ranges encountered in whitetail hunting.
Wind drift is a practical consideration for any hunter, particularly when making shots at extended ranges. Bullets with higher ballistic coefficients and higher muzzle velocities will generally experience less wind drift. However, understanding how to compensate for wind is a skill that can be learned and practiced. Factors such as bullet weight and jacket construction can also influence how a bullet interacts with wind. Heavier bullets, due to their greater mass and momentum, are less susceptible to wind deflection than lighter projectiles. Ultimately, effective ballistic performance on whitetail deer is a synergistic outcome of projectile design, rifle system, and shooter proficiency, all working together to achieve an ethical and effective shot.
Rifle Calibers Commonly Used for Whitetail
Several rifle calibers have earned a reputation as workhorses for whitetail deer hunting, offering a proven track record of effectiveness and reliability. The .30-06 Springfield remains a perennial favorite due to its versatility, ample power, and widespread availability. It provides a good balance of manageable recoil and sufficient energy for ethical harvests at typical whitetail ranges, and it can be effectively chambered in a variety of rifle platforms. Its broad range of bullet weights allows hunters to tailor performance to specific conditions and preferences, from lighter, faster bullets for flatter trajectories to heavier slugs for deeper penetration.
The .308 Winchester is another immensely popular choice, often lauded for its compact cartridge size, making it well-suited for shorter-action rifles, which can be lighter and handier in the field. It offers excellent ballistics and is renowned for its accuracy, making it a dependable option for a wide array of hunting scenarios. While it has slightly less case capacity and thus potentially less velocity and energy than the .30-06 at extreme ranges, its performance on whitetail out to 300-400 yards is exceptional and well-documented. Its manageable recoil also makes it a favorite for new hunters or those sensitive to heavier recoil.
Moving into more specialized yet highly effective calibers, the 6.5 Creedmoor has rapidly ascended in popularity for whitetail hunting, particularly among those who appreciate its inherent accuracy and remarkably mild recoil. Its aerodynamic bullet designs contribute to excellent ballistic coefficients, resulting in flat trajectories and reduced wind drift, making longer shots more achievable and manageable. The quality of modern 6.5mm bullets ensures excellent terminal performance, often rivaling larger calibers in terms of energy transfer and tissue damage when properly placed.
Other notable calibers include the .270 Winchester, a classic choice known for its flat trajectory and excellent performance at medium to long ranges, and the .243 Winchester, which, despite its smaller diameter, can be highly effective on whitetail when paired with premium, expanding bullets and used within its optimal range. The .270’s velocity allows for less holdover at distance, and its larger diameter often translates to more significant wound channels with well-constructed bullets. The .243, while requiring careful shot placement, offers very low recoil, making it an attractive option for younger or smaller-framed hunters. The selection often comes down to individual preference, rifle platform, and the specific hunting environments anticipated.
Tips for Accurate and Ethical Whitetail Shots
Achieving accurate and ethical shots on whitetail deer is a fundamental goal for any responsible hunter, and it begins with understanding the anatomy of the animal and the vital zones. The primary vital area is the chest cavity, encompassing the heart and lungs. A well-placed shot in this region will cause rapid incapacitation and a humane kill. Aiming slightly behind the shoulder, approximately one-third of the way up the chest, targets the heart and lungs effectively. The neck, while also containing vital structures, is a much smaller target and is generally considered a secondary option unless the situation dictates otherwise. Understanding the deer’s quartering angle – whether it’s facing away, towards, or sideways – is crucial for determining the optimal shot placement to ensure penetration through the vitals.
Practice is indispensable for developing the marksmanship required for ethical hunting. This means consistent practice with your chosen rifle and ammunition at varying distances, simulating real hunting scenarios as closely as possible. Dry-fire practice, utilizing a bore-sighted rifle or laser training cartridge, can help refine trigger control and sight alignment without expending ammunition. Attending a reputable shooting course or working with a qualified instructor can provide invaluable feedback and accelerate skill development. Familiarity with your rifle’s trajectory and how to compensate for bullet drop at different ranges is also a critical component of accurate shooting.
Understanding and utilizing range estimation techniques is vital for accurate shot placement, especially when hunting in diverse terrain where distances can vary significantly. While modern rangefinders are highly accurate and recommended, developing your ability to estimate range by eye can serve as a valuable backup. Practicing range estimation in various environments, such as fields and wooded areas, can improve your proficiency. Once the range is determined, ensure your rifle’s sights or scope are correctly zeroed for that distance. Knowing your rifle’s maximum point-blank range can also simplify aiming at closer distances, as the bullet will remain within a few inches of the point of aim from the muzzle out to that range.
Finally, ethical hunting extends beyond accurate shot placement to include shot discipline and the commitment to recover downed game. This means waiting for the optimal shot opportunity – a stationary target with a clear view of the vital zone. Rushing a shot on a moving or partially obscured deer increases the risk of wounding rather than cleanly harvesting. If a deer is hit but not immediately incapacitated, practice patience and observe its reaction. Follow up with a second shot if necessary and safe to do so. After the shot, allow the animal adequate time to expire before beginning the tracking process. Employing effective tracking techniques, such as looking for blood trails and hair, is essential to ensure the recovery of your game.

2. Bullet Construction: The Key to Effective Terminal Ballistics
Bullet construction plays a pivotal role in how a projectile performs upon impact with a whitetail deer. The primary goal is to achieve controlled expansion, creating a larger wound channel for efficient tissue damage and energy transfer, while also ensuring sufficient penetration to reach vital organs. Common bullet types include soft-point, ballistic tip, and controlled-expansion designs. Soft-point bullets feature an exposed lead tip that readily deforms upon impact, promoting expansion. Ballistic tip bullets, with their polymer tips, often offer a more consistent and predictable expansion profile, especially at varying velocities. Controlled-expansion bullets, such as bonded core or partition designs, are engineered to prevent over-expansion and core-jacket separation, ensuring deeper penetration through bone and muscle.
The effectiveness of different bullet constructions is often dictated by the impact velocity. For instance, some lighter varmint-style bullets, while fast, may fragment upon hitting bone or heavier muscle tissue, failing to achieve adequate penetration. Conversely, heavier, tougher bullets designed for larger game might not expand sufficiently at lower impact velocities, leading to reduced wound channels. Data from terminal ballistics testing, often conducted using ballistic gelatin, illustrates these differences. For whitetail deer, a bullet that reliably expands to a diameter of approximately 1.5 to 2 times its original size while retaining at least 60-70% of its original weight is generally considered optimal. This balance ensures both a wide wound channel for rapid incapacitation and sufficient mass to penetrate to the heart and lungs. Understanding these principles is fundamental to selecting the best rounds for whitetail deer that perform reliably across a range of common hunting scenarios.
3. Energy Transfer and Momentum: Driving Lethality
The kinetic energy and momentum of a bullet are direct indicators of its potential to inflict damage. Kinetic energy, calculated as half the mass times the velocity squared (KE = 0.5mv²), represents the energy a bullet carries. Momentum, calculated as mass times velocity (p = mv), is a measure of its “push.” While both are important, momentum is often considered a better predictor of penetration. A bullet with sufficient momentum will have the mass and velocity to push through muscle and bone to reach vital organs. For whitetail deer, a commonly cited minimum kinetic energy threshold is around 1,000 foot-pounds at the point of impact, though this can be subjective and depends heavily on bullet construction and placement.
However, simply meeting an energy threshold does not guarantee a quick kill. The way energy is transferred is critical. Bullets designed to expand upon impact transfer their energy more rapidly within the target, creating a larger wound channel and causing more immediate trauma. This controlled energy release, coupled with adequate momentum for penetration, is what leads to humane harvests. For example, a heavy, well-constructed bullet fired from a moderately powerful cartridge might have less peak kinetic energy than a lighter, faster bullet from a magnum cartridge, but it could still prove more effective due to its superior momentum and controlled expansion, ensuring deeper penetration and a more reliable vital organ hit. Careful consideration of both energy and momentum, in conjunction with bullet design, is crucial for selecting ammunition that consistently delivers ethical results.
4. Effective Range: Matching Your Hunting Style
The effective range of a particular round is not solely dictated by the ballistic coefficient and muzzle velocity of the bullet, but also by the hunter’s ability to accurately place shots at those distances and the bullet’s ability to retain sufficient energy and momentum. While many modern cartridges boast impressive “out to 500 yards” claims, most whitetail hunting occurs at much closer ranges, typically between 50 and 200 yards. Understanding your personal shooting capabilities and the typical engagement distances in your preferred hunting environments is paramount. A cartridge that is exceptionally accurate at 500 yards is of little practical benefit if your longest shot is consistently under 100 yards, and conversely, a cartridge optimized for close-quarters might lack the ballistic properties for accurate longer shots.
Furthermore, the effective range must also consider the bullet’s performance. As a bullet travels further, it loses velocity and energy. This can significantly impact its ability to expand reliably upon impact, particularly with certain bullet designs. Data from ballistic tables often indicates when a bullet drops below its optimal expansion velocity, which can vary significantly between different bullet types and weights. For instance, a bonded soft-point bullet might retain its integrity at longer ranges but fail to expand adequately if it impacts at a velocity below its designed threshold. Therefore, when considering effective range, it is imperative to look beyond advertised maximums and focus on the distance at which the chosen bullet reliably performs its terminal ballistics functions. This practical consideration is vital for making informed choices about the best rounds for whitetail deer.
5. Recoil and Muzzle Blast: Shooter Comfort and Accuracy
The recoil and muzzle blast generated by a firearm and its ammunition are significant factors that directly influence a shooter’s ability to place accurate shots, especially during the critical moment of engagement. Excessive recoil can lead to flinching, a subconscious anticipation of the gun’s kick that can throw off the shooter’s aim, resulting in wounded game. Similarly, a loud and concussive muzzle blast can be disorienting, particularly for younger or less experienced hunters. The interplay between bullet weight, powder charge, and firearm action all contribute to the perceived recoil. Lighter rifle platforms will naturally exhibit more felt recoil with the same ammunition compared to heavier ones.
For whitetail hunting, where precise shot placement on vital organs is paramount, maintaining shooter control is essential. Cartridges that offer a manageable recoil impulse allow for a more stable shooting platform, facilitating consistent accuracy. For example, a .270 Winchester or a .308 Winchester are generally considered to have manageable recoil for most adult shooters, allowing for comfortable practice and confident shooting in the field. In contrast, magnum cartridges, while powerful, can produce significantly more felt recoil, potentially hindering accuracy for some individuals. Modern ammunition manufacturers also offer reduced-recoil loads in popular calibers, which can be an excellent option for shooters sensitive to recoil, ensuring they can shoot accurately without discomfort.

How does bullet construction (e.g., soft point, bonded, hollow point) affect performance on whitetail deer?
Bullet construction significantly influences terminal performance on whitetail deer by dictating how the projectile interacts with tissue and bone. Soft point bullets, characterized by an exposed lead tip, are designed to initiate expansion upon impact, offering a good balance of expansion and penetration for many common whitetail hunting distances. Bonded bullets, where the jacket and core are permanently fused, are engineered for controlled expansion with superior weight retention, making them excellent for penetrating heavier bone or tissue, thereby increasing the likelihood of reaching vital organs even on angled shots.
Hollow point (HP) bullets are designed for rapid expansion, often creating a larger wound cavity. However, their suitability for whitetail hunting can be variable. While effective at close to medium ranges for quick expansion, they may fragment or lack sufficient penetration on larger deer or when encountering bone at longer distances. Choosing the appropriate construction depends on the expected range, the size of the deer, and the shooter’s ability to place precise shots, with bonded and well-designed soft point bullets generally considered more forgiving for consistent performance.

How important is bullet weight for whitetail deer hunting?
Bullet weight is a critical factor in whitetail deer hunting as it directly influences the projectile’s momentum and energy retention downrange. Heavier bullets, within a given caliber, generally carry more momentum, which translates to better penetration and a more substantial wound channel. This increased momentum is particularly advantageous when encountering bone, such as the shoulder, or when the deer presents an angled shot, as it helps ensure the bullet reaches the vital organs.
While heavier bullets offer benefits, it’s important to match the bullet weight to the specific caliber and the intended purpose. For example, within the .30 caliber family, 150-grain and 180-grain bullets are commonly used for whitetails. The 150-grain offers a flatter trajectory and is excellent for moderate distances, while the 180-grain provides more energy and penetration for longer shots or larger deer. Ultimately, a judicious selection of bullet weight, paired with appropriate bullet construction and caliber, is essential for maximizing the likelihood of an ethical and effective harvest.
